Software Developer

  • Huntsville, AL
  • Posted 8 hours ago | Updated 8 hours ago

Overview

On Site
USD 85,150.00 - 153,925.00 per year
Full Time

Skills

Adobe AIR
Geospatial Analysis
Data Analysis
Cyber Security
Logistics
Training
Intelligence Analysis
Web Applications
Collaboration
Computer Science
Computer Engineering
Software Development
Orchestration
Kubernetes
Docker
.NET
Data Structure
OOD
Unit Testing
People Skills
Writing
Attention To Detail
Web Development
React.js
AngularJS
Node.js
Client/server
Application Development
WPF
MVVM
Design Patterns
Microsoft Visual Studio
Microsoft
ADS
Git
Market Analysis
Law

Job Details

Looking for an opportunity to make an impact?

At Leidos, we deliver innovative solutions through the efforts of our diverse and talented people who are dedicated to our customers' success. We empower our teams, contribute to our communities, and operate sustainable. Everything we do is built on a commitment to do the right thing for our customers, our people, and our community. Our Mission, Vision, and Values guide the way we do business.

Your greatest work is ahead!

Leidos Defense Systems Sector is seeking a talented Software Developer to join a diverse team to create unique solutions for complex problems. Leidos Defense Systems Sector provides a diverse portfolio of systems, solutions, and services covering land, sea, air, space, and cyberspace for customers worldwide. Solutions for Defense include enterprise and mission IT, large-scale intelligence systems, command and control, geospatial and data analytics, cybersecurity, logistics, training, and intelligence analysis and operations support. Our team is solving the world's toughest security challenges for customers with "can't fail" missions. To explore and learn more, click here!

In this role, you will join a team that develops software solutions for our customers in the area of Unmanned Aerial Systems simulation. You will use your skills to design and implement scalable web applications, fix bugs, perform peer reviews, write tests, analyze new technologies and best practices, and collaborate with other teammates.

Emphasis is placed on the utilization of existing and leading-edge tools to provide cost- effective and timely solutions to our customer. The team consists of highly skilled professionals that have strong fundamental skills, exercise best practices, conduct peer reviews, and exceeds customer expectations.

Basic Qualifications
  • Candidate must possess a Bachelor's or Master's degree in Computer Science, Computer Engineering, or equivalent degree from an ABET accredited school with a minimum of 4+ years of applicable experience or 2+ years with MS degree.

  • Candidate must have software development experience and demonstrate knowledge of container orchestration solutions such as Kubernetes or Docker, web development, .NET, as well as data structures, object-oriented design, and effective unit testing.

  • Candidate should be self-disciplined with good people skills, writing skills, attention to detail, and strong technical interests/capabilities.

  • Candidate must be a resident of the North Alabama area or willing to relocate to the Huntsville - North Alabama, AL area


    Preferred Qualifications
    • Experience with web development technologies such as: React, Angular, NodeJS, or similar front and backend frameworks.

    • Experience with Client/Server application development.

    • Knowledge of WPF and experience using the Model-View-ViewModel (MVVM) design pattern is preferred.

    • Knowledge and experience in Microsoft Visual Studio, Microsoft ADS, and Git are considered a plus.

    Original Posting:
    May 14, 2025
    For U.S. Positions: While subject to change based on business needs, Leidos reasonably anticipates that this job requisition will remain open for at least 3 days with an anticipated close date of no earlier than 3 days after the original posting date as listed above.

    Pay Range:
    Pay Range $85,150.00 - $153,925.00

    The Leidos pay range for this job level is a general guideline only and not a guarantee of compensation or salary. Additional factors considered in extending an offer include (but are not limited to) responsibilities of the job, education, experience, knowledge, skills, and abilities, as well as internal equity, alignment with market data, applicable bargaining agreement (if any), or other law.
    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.